2013-09-20 2 views
2

Есть ли способ, когда разработчик совершает несколько файлов (предположим, 5 файлов), генерируется только одна ревизия?Номера версий SVN для нескольких файловых коммитов

Или каждый файл фиксирует, независимо от того, как он зафиксирован, всегда вызывает создание нового номера редакции?

ответ

2

Если файлы зафиксированы сразу, создается только одна ревизия.

Пример svn log выход:

r41614 | blorg | 2013-08-29 15:16:49 +1200 (Thu, 29 Aug 2013) | 2 lines 
Changed paths: 
    M /customers/Footech/PricingDatabaseLoader.cs 
    M /customers/Footech/CreditRecharge.cs 
    M /customers/Footech/build.cfg 

Здесь мы имеем одну правку (r41614), в котором были совершены 3 файлов.

+0

Итак, если в Eclipse я выбираю весь проект и фиксирую проект, даже если он имеет 1000 измененных файлов, тогда будет создан только один номер версии для всех 1000 файлы зафиксированы? – user1888243

+1

Да, это так. Каждая отдельная фиксация получает уникальный номер версии; но в каждой фиксации может быть много изменений. – Blorgbeard

+0

Спасибо, что ответили на мой вопрос. – user1888243

1

Если вы храните несколько файлов вместе, для всех файлов будет один номер версии. т. е. это однократное изменение набора, имеющее несколько файлов.

Смежные вопросы